Item Description
Motor City Memoirs book
Motor City Memoirs by Jennifer Thomas Vanadia (Editor), John Sobczak (Photographer), donated by Yellow Door Art.
Grand Central Station Print from Signal Return Press
8.5 x 11 print of Detroit's Grand Central Station that reads "Speramus meliora; resurgent cineribus" which means "We hope for better things; it will rise from the ashes."
Tile, tour and 1 year membership from Pewabic Pottery
One Detroit tile that reads "Life is Worth Living in Detroit" from the city's 1913 slogan 'Behind the Scenes' tour for 20, and a 1 year Individual membership to the Pewabic Society.
